CU Grading Policies

University of Colorado Grading System

Letter Grades: 4.0 absolute scale

A 4.0 (points per credit hour) No A+ grade allowed
B 3.0

 

C 2.0

minimum for proficiency grade

D 1.0

D-, minimum passing grade

F 0.0 Failing, no credit, no F+ or F- grades

Plus/Minus Grades (faculty option)

+ grade, add 0.3 points. If you earn a B+, it is worth 3.3 points per credit hour

- grade, subtract 0.3 points. If you earn a C-, it is worth 1.7 points per credit hour

Optional Grades

Incompletes (IW or IF)

  • Given by faculty discretion when there are special circumstances that preclude course completion
  • Only a small portion of the course remains: 75% of the work in the course must be completed
  • Up to 12 months to complete the unfinished portion of the course
    • After 12 months, IF will become an F
    • After 12 months, IW will become a W

Pass/Fail

  • Core knowledge areas and electives are the only courses that can be taken pass/fail
    • No Core Skills courses or major/minor courses
  • D- or better is translated by the Records office into a P (pass) grade.
  • P grades do not affect your GPA

No Credit

  • This will appear on your official transcript and audit as non-credit course

Repeated Courses

  • Credit is only given once.
  • Both grades will appear on the transcript
  • Both grades will be configured into the cumulative GPA
    • no course forgiveness policy at UCD

Cumulative Grade Point Average

The cumulative grade point average is a numeric average of the letter grades received in CU courses.

Included in GPA Excluded from GPA
CU letter graded courses

MSCD common pool courses

CU extended studies courses Transfer courses into CU
CU correspondence courses

Courses with IW or IF grades

Repeated courses  

GPA = total grade points ÷ total graded credits attempted.
